What this opportunity involves:
We are seeking an experienced Senior / Transaction Manager to join us! This is a high-impact role for a seasoned leasing professional who thrives on complex commercial negotiations and strategic portfolio management.
Reporting to the National Retail Leasing Director, you will lead the negotiation and execution of complex, high-value retail lease transactions across a designated portfolio. Your focus will be on renewals, relocations, restructures, refurbishments, and make-good obligations—driving optimal commercial outcomes aligned to Client strategy.
This role requires strong commercial acumen, senior-level stakeholder management, and the ability to operate autonomously while contributing strategically to portfolio-wide leasing initiatives.

Key Responsibilities:
- Lead negotiations for retail lease transactions including renewals, relocations, restructures, refurbishments, and make-good obligations, with a focus on complex and high-value deals.
-
Manage negotiations with major landlords, institutional owners, and shopping centre operators to achieve favourable commercial, net effective rent, and risk outcomes.
-
Drive rental outcomes within market parameters while balancing commercial, operational, and customer considerations.
-
Proactively manage critical dates, lease options, and obligations in accordance with lease terms.
-
Contribute to the development and execution of portfolio-wide leasing strategies, policies, and governance frameworks.
-
Provide accurate and timely commercial instructions to Lease Administration and paralegal teams, ensuring data integrity throughout the lease execution process.
-
Serve as the commercial escalation point for complex transactions during lease documentation.
-
Build and maintain strong relationships with key retail landlords, developers, and industry contacts to identify market opportunities and risks.
-
Provide mentoring and informal guidance to junior leasing team members, fostering capability development and best-practice outcomes.
-
Collaborate with internal JLL stakeholders to deliver integrated, client-focused results.
